xpate, the all-in-one payments and banking hub, will participate in PAY360 2026, taking place on 25 and 26 March 2026 at ExCeL London. The company will exhibit in hall S6 at stand G20, just along from Visa and Paybis, where attendees can engage with the xpate team and explore how unified financial infrastructure supports modern digital businesses.

xpate’s attendance stretches beyond their exhibition stand, with Oleg Seitov, Head of Finance at xpate, taking part in the panel discussion “Winning with smarter data calls: Strengthening the core of your financial infrastructure” on Day 1 (25 March, 13:30 UK time) on the Resilience Stage. The session will address ISO 20022 adoption, enriching structured transaction data, integrating real-time APIs into legacy banking infrastructure, and balancing data availability with privacy and security requirements. Oleg will appear alongside globally renowned representatives from JPMorgan Chase, Bank of America, NatWest and LexisNexis Risk Solutions, with the session moderated by Chris Skinner, CEO of The Finanser.

“Our participation at PAY360 reflects xpate’s focus on building scalable financial infrastructure in a rapidly evolving payments ecosystem,” said Oleg Seitov, Head of Finance at xpate. “As the industry moves towards richer data standards like ISO 20022, the real opportunity lies in how that data is used. Better data enables automation, reduces operational complexity, and ultimately improves margins. For us, it’s not just about adopting standards, it’s about building systems that can fully leverage them.” Seitov continued.
